Abstract

Mathematics learning videos are audio visual media that make lessons more engaging by aligning with students’ audio-visual learning styles and illustrating real-life applications through digital storytelling. However, numeracy performance remains low—only 19% (4 of 21 students) mastered topics like mean, median, mode, and range. Efforts to address this problem are to use mathematics learning videos based on digital storytelling to strengthen students’ numeracy. This study aims to describe the content validity making such a video for strengthening students’ numeracy skills. In this research used the ADDIE development model, which focuses on three stages: Analyze, Design, and Develop with evaluations at each stage. However, this article focuses on the validation assessment of mathematics learning videos based on digital storytelling. The instruments used consist of a material expert validation instrument and a learning video validation instrument. The media was validated by three experts in the field of learning media, visual programming, and digital storytelling. The data analysis technique uses the Aiken V formula. Based on this, the results of the validation analysis are shown by obtaining a score of 0.854 from video experts (highest in usefulness) and 0.83 from material experts (highest in learning objectives) both were categorized as valid. The assessment by experts shows that the mathematics learning video is suitable for use with revisions. Several revisions were made to mathematics learning video based on digital storytelling to make it more interesting. Further research is recommended to develop the mathematics learning video into an application that can be used offline and allows for automatic answer storage settings.
